Compliance and Safety Documentation
Regulatory compliance is non-negotiable for chopping board procurement, particularly when dealing with food-contact materials. Buyers must ensure that suppliers provide valid certificates from recognized testing laboratories, such as FDA and LFGB approvals, which verify that the materials do not leach harmful substances into food. These certifications are often accompanied by test reports detailing migration limits for heavy metals and other contaminants. For products claiming eco-friendly status, additional certifications such as FSC (Forest Stewardship Council) may be relevant, although their applicability depends on the specific material composition, such as bamboo or wood blends. Buyers should verify the authenticity of these certificates by checking the issuing body's accreditation and the validity period of the documents.
Beyond food safety, environmental compliance is increasingly important, with regulations like REACH in Europe restricting the use of certain hazardous chemicals. Buyers should inquire about the supplier's adherence to these regulations and request documentation proving the absence of restricted substances. For acrylic-based products, this may involve verifying the use of pure sulphate formulas or other approved chemical compositions. Additionally, fireproof ratings, such as Class A1 Non-Combustible, may be required for commercial kitchen environments to meet building and safety codes. By rigorously checking these compliance documents, buyers can protect their brand reputation and avoid legal liabilities associated with non-compliant products.

Supplier Qualification and Quality Control
Selecting a reliable supplier involves assessing their manufacturing capabilities, quality control processes, and track record. Buyers should conduct factory audits or request third-party inspection reports to verify production standards and working conditions. Key quality control checkpoints include material testing, dimensional accuracy, and surface finish inspection. Suppliers with established quality management systems, such as ISO certifications, are generally more reliable in delivering consistent product quality. Additionally, buyers should evaluate the supplier's ability to handle customization requests, including logo placement and packaging design, without compromising product integrity.
Post-production quality assurance is equally important, with buyers implementing incoming inspection protocols to verify product conformity. Random sampling based on statistical standards can help identify defects early in the supply chain. Suppliers should provide detailed inspection reports for each batch, including test results for antibacterial efficacy and durability. For eco-friendly products, verifying the source of raw materials and the recycling content percentage is crucial. By establishing a robust supplier qualification and quality control framework, buyers can minimize the risk of receiving substandard goods and maintain high customer satisfaction levels.
